How Our Concrete Slab Water Extraction Process Works

Our team employs a meticulous process to ensure efficient and effective Concrete Slab Water Extraction. We’ll start by assessing the damage and developing a customized plan to meet your needs. Our technicians will then employ state-of-the-art equipment to extract water from the affected area, using techniques such as truck-mounted extractors and wet vacuums.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ll assess the extent of the damage and create a personalized plan to restore your property. Our team will identify the source of the water intrusion and develop a strategy to prevent future occurrences.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use truck-mounted extractors and wet vacuums to remove standing water from the affected area. We’ll target areas with the most water to reduce drying time and pr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ll employ specialized dr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the slab and surrounding areas. Our team will monitor humidity levels to ensure a safe and healthy environment.

Step 4: Disinfection and Sanitizing

We’ll apply disinfectants to remove any remaining bacteria, viruses, or mold spores. Our technicians will ensure a thorough cleaning of the affected area.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the restoration is complete and the area is safe for occupancy. Any necessary touch-ups will be addressed at this time.

Concrete Slab Water Extraction Cost in Schwenksville, PA

The cost of Concrete Slab Water Extraction services in Schwenksville, PA, can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Average costs range from $500 to $2,500 depending on the extent of the damage and the necessary repairs. These estimates are based on real-world costs and are subject to change based on the specifics of your situ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, humidity levels
Disinfection and Sanitizing $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of disinfectant used
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of repairs

What is the difference between Concrete Slab Water Extraction and drying?

Concrete Slab Water Extraction refers to the removal of water from the affected area, while drying involves the use of spec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from the area. Both processes are essential to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living environment.
